Multi-Skilled Plant and Machinery Engineer
Do you thrive in a fast-paced environment where you can make a real impact? Are you passionate about ensuring the smooth operation of critical machinery? We're looking for a dedicated and skilled engineer to join our team and keep our operations running smoothly.
What you'll do:
...
- You'll be responsible for the daily maintenance and repair of a wide range of plant and machinery, ensuring maximum uptime and productivity.
- This includes diagnosing and resolving complex issues, performing preventative maintenance, and supporting emergency repairs.
- You'll lead a team of engineers, providing guidance, training, and support to ensure everyone is working safely and efficiently.
- You'll play a key role in implementing and improving our maintenance processes, ensuring that all equipment meets industry standards and safety regulations.
What you'll need:
- A strong background in plant, agricultural machinery, or HGV engineering with experience in preventative maintenance and repairs.
- A solid understanding of mechanical systems and a demonstrated ability to diagnose and resolve complex issues.
- Experience in team supervision and a proven ability to motivate and guide others.
- A strong commitment to safe work practices and the ability to ensure the well-being of yourself and your team.
Bonus points if you have:
* Experience in the construction, civil engineering, or waste industries.
* Expertise with excavators, dumpers, and compaction equipment.
* Welding and gas cutting skills.
